Wei Jinfeng Former Deputy Director of Guangdong Provincial Finance Department under Investigation

  On November 16, according to Guangdong procuratorate organ, Wei Jinfeng, former Deputy Director of Guangdong Provincial Finance Department, was under the second trial for taking bribes and gaining illegal profits totaled over 30 million yuan. He was also found in possession of over 40 million yuan which he couldn’t explain the source of.
  With the authority of financial fund approval, Wei Jinfeng became a link of the corruption chain in the financial system of local government.
  Documents show that Wei Jinfeng successively served as Enterprise Section Chief, Industrial Trade Section Chief and Deputy Director of Guangdong Provincial Finance Department from September, 2003, holding the responsibilities of overseeing and managing the corporate financial fund support, loss subsidy and tax return. He also controlled several special funds, environment protection fund for instance. He had a decisive influence on where these much-coveted funds go.
  The investigation of Guangdong Provincial Discipline Inspection Commission says that Wei Jinfeng has seriously abused his positions in the Finance Department by seeking illegal interests, taking bribes and illegally reselling state-owned lands for excessive profits. Through profiteering, his family fortune amounted as high as 70 million yuan.
